About
I am currently an Assistant Professor at the Gaoling School of Artificial Intelligence, Renmin University of China. I received my B.S. degree from the School of Mathematical Sciences, East China Normal University in 2019, and my Ph.D. degree from the Academy of Mathematics and Systems Science, Chinese Academy of Sciences in 2024. From 2024 to 2026, I was a Postdoctoral Researcher at the Gaoling School of Artificial Intelligence, Renmin University of China. My research focuses on the theory, algorithms, and applications of intelligent scientific computing, with particular interests in integrating physical laws with deep learning for the modeling, inversion, control, and optimization of complex physical systems.
